Shakira Petit M.Ed., MBA has extensive instructional leadership experiences, coupled with numerous teaching and management successes. Shakira joined the ranks of Democrats for Education Reform in October of 2021 as the Chief Operating Officer, and has served as the National President since 2023. Shakira is an educator with over 17 years of experience in the field of education administration both internationally and domestically. Shakira Petit has taught over 11,000 students in six different countries over her tenure including research expeditions with NSF and NASA to Antarctica.

Shakira has been featured in Ebony Magazine, NY Times, Miami Herald, and numerous other publications. Moreover, Shakira served with the Harlem Children’s Zone under the leadership of Geoffrey Canada for 9 years as a teacher, Science Department Chair, Assistant Principal for the High School and Principal of the Middle School. Shakira Petit has served as the Deputy Superintendent for Greenburgh-Graham Union Free School District in Hastings-on-Hudson after moving up the ranks from Curriculum Supervisor to Principal within three years. GGUFSD is one of the last few Special Act. Districts in the state of NY which supports and serves students who in addition to having special needs are also from New York’s most vulnerable populations.

Shakira holds an MBA from NYU and a Masters of Leadership in Education from Mercy College.
